Shares, which represent partial ownership of a company, are categorized as common stock, preferred stock, and equity not fully paid. Shares generally have the following three meanings: 1. Shares are a constituent of the capital of a stock corporation. 2. Shares can express their value in the form of a stock price. 3. Shares represent the rights and obligations of stockholders in a stock corporation.
